INTRODUCTION
Clark Hill PLC seeks an experienced full-time Legal Administrative Assistant in its Scottsdale Office.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ITIES
This position reports to the Office Manager, as well as to assigned attorneys, and is responsible for, among other activities:
- Providing the requisite legal secretarial and administrative support/clerical needs of assigned attorneys
- Preparing letters, memos, and other documentation, as required
- Entering client information into the system to run conflict checks for new clients, as well as preparation of supporting documentation such as engagement letters
- Making travel arrangements and preparing expense reimbursement documentation
- Answering the phones of assigned attorneys
- Entering attorney time
BASIC QUALIFICATIONS
- A minimum of 3 years of Intellectual Property experience
- Ability to work in a team environment
- Must possess the ability to navigate various patent and trademark databases, portals, and filing systems at the United States Patent and Trademark Office (“USPTO”)
- Must possess in-depth knowledge of the patent, trademark, and copyright application/prosecution processes and procedures (both U.S and foreign), terminology, forms, and associated deadlines
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
- Provides specialized support to patent and trademark group, with a thorough understanding of internal and external patent and trademark practices, procedures and requirements relating to all phases of filing, prosecuting, and maintaining patents and trademarks for Firm clients
- Assists with patent, trademark, and copyright due diligence
- Maintains IP Department-specific databases and electronic files
- Prepares and files documents with the USPTO including patent and trademark applications, responses, assignments, powers of attorney, etc.
- Works closely with attorneys and paralegals on all aspects of patent, trademark, and copyright applications
- Establishes and maintains calendar and deadline reminder systems; utilizes the Firm and IP department calendar system; schedule appointments for timekeepers as necessary and/or as requested
While this position assists attorneys in the Intellectual Property area, the successful candidate must be willing and able to help attorneys, legal assistants, and others in other areas. The successful candidate will have excellent computer skills utilizing all aspects of Office 365 and will have excellent attention to detail with superb proofreading skills. Candidates must be able to prioritize and manage a high-volume and diverse workload and thus must be able to handle multiple tasks at one time with exceptional organizational skills. A team player, the candidate must be able to absorb information quickly and adapt to change. Sound judgment and business acumen when interacting with clients, potential clients, guests, coworkers, and others is a must. Certified Legal Secretary designation is a plus.
COMPENSATION
- Salary Range: $65,000-$75,000 annually, based upon a full-time work schedule. Actual compensation will be influenced by various factors, including but not limited to employee qualifications, relevant experience, skill sets, training, internal equity, and market data. This position is eligible for an annual discretionary bonus.
In addition, Clark Hill offers employees the ability to participate in health insurance with optional HSA/FSA, short-term disability, long-term disability, dental insurance, vision care, life insurance, 401K, paid time off, parking/public transportation allowance, and an employee assistance program.
